Preventive foot care is essential, especially for patients with diabetic issues. It consists of daily foot inspection for accidents and lesions; cure of calluses and corns by a podiatrist; daily washing with the feet in lukewarm drinking water with mild cleaning soap, accompanied by Light, complete drying; and avoidance of thermal, chemical, and mechanical personal injury, In particular that as a consequence of improperly fitting footwear. Atherosclerosis will cause disease in two means. 1) Atherosclerosis can limit the ability from the narrowed arteries to boost shipping and delivery of blood and oxygen into the tissues of your body for the duration of periods when oxygen desire really should be greater, by way of example, through exertion; or 2) total obstruction of the artery by a thrombus or embolus (thrombus and embolus are forms of blood clots), which results in tissue Dying (necrosis).

Peripheral vascular disease related to atherosclerosis could be prevented by reducing the chance elements which are controllable, like ingesting a heart-healthy diet regime, retaining a nutritious bodyweight, not smoking, getting common physical exercise, and protecting great Charge of blood sugar ranges When you have diabetes.

When symptomatic, PAD results in intermittent claudication, that's distress in the legs that occurs during going for walks and is particularly relieved by rest; It's a manifestation of physical exercise-induced reversible ischemia, similar to angina pectoris.

PVD occurs as a result of plaque buildup in the arteries’ lining. This plaque narrows the blood vessels, limiting or blocking blood movement across the physique.

The physician will conduct a Bodily Test and hunt for symptoms and indicators of peripheral artery disease, for instance, weak or absent artery pulses from the extremities, bruits (sounds which can be read by way of a stethoscope), hypertension modifications, and skin colour and nail improvements

Atherosclerosis is usually a gradual approach whereby difficult cholesterol substances (plaques) are deposited in the walls with the arteries. This buildup of cholesterol plaques triggers hardening with the artery partitions and narrowing from the interior channel find jobs near me (lumen) of the artery. When this takes place from the peripheral circulation, peripheral vascular disease is the result. The atherosclerosis system starts early in life (as early as teenagers in some individuals).
